Aww, I'm sorry to hear how horrible it's been!
The only things I can think of are swishing some warm salt-water and maybe avoiding super hot or cold foods while your teeth are more sensitive. Rubbing something like Anbesol (a toothache medicine) on your gums might help too. I've only used it once when I had a particularly achy tooth that hurt all the way up into my gums, and although it made my tongue and lips numb too, it did stop the pain... ;P
